Palestinians Wait for Hours to Cast Votes; Turnout May Reach 90% in Town, Village Elections

Summary


JERICHO, West Bank Thousands of voters overwhelmed polling stations in scattered West Bank towns and villages on Thursday as Palestinians voted in their first local elections in nearly three decades.

The polls gave Palestinians in 26 small communities a democratic dry run ahead of Jan. 9 elections to replace Yasser Arafat as head of the Palestinian Authority.
